The pedal feels normal and will shift fine for a few gear changes, then gradually gets worse with each shift. It feels like the clutch itself is moving less everytime you push it. When I went for my test drive the day after it started, eventually it was not disengaging hardly at all. You could hear the rattle still, but when pushing the clutch while moving( say to stop at a red light) the rpms did not drop to idle. They stayed steady with the truck speed until I got it jerked out of gear. I don't think its anything in the trans, the clutch is not disengaging.
